      I started capping US Sports thru 2005. Before US Sports, I was capping soccer only. Started with basketball and then I discovered hockey. It was 2006 or 2007 if I recall correctly. I noticed beating hockey was far easier then basketball. When I was new to hockey, I was playing favourites and juicy totals, lol. Still made nice profit even with these odds. Then I found out there's a gold mine in NHL; Underdogs! Then focused on dogs, made x46.58 Unit last season (Your Regular Stake x 46). This season, I'm only x1.07 Unit so far but feeling hopeful about future. Will be glad if I can make x50 thru end of season.

      So my advice is, focus on dogs, look for dogs! But don't bet all dogs blindly of course..
